Mango Lime Daiquiri
Ingredients
2 mango, peeled and chopped
Juice of 1/2 lime
3 oz of rum ( I used Topper’s Spiced Rhum)
1 tbsp organic sugar
1 cup of ice
Blend mango, lime juice, and Spice Rhum in blender until smooth. Add ice and blend until ice is crushed.
Pour into glass and enjoy!
